Frequently Asked Questions
College essay tutoring focuses on helping you craft compelling application essays that showcase your unique voice and story. Tutors work with you on brainstorming topics, developing a strong thesis, structuring your essay for maximum impact, and refining your writing through multiple revision rounds. Whether you're working on your main Common App essay or supplemental prompts, personalized 1-on-1 instruction helps you navigate the entire writing process.
Your first session focuses on understanding your goals, reviewing any essay prompts, and brainstorming ideas that reflect your authentic self. From there, tutors help you outline your essay, draft your response, and provide detailed feedback on structure, clarity, and voice. Most students benefit from multiple sessions spread across several weeks, allowing time to revise between meetings and build confidence in their final submission.
Many students struggle to balance sounding "impressive" with sounding like themselves—tutors help you find that balance. Through guided conversations and feedback on your drafts, tutors identify what makes your perspective unique and help you express it naturally on the page. This personalized approach ensures your essay sounds genuinely like you, which admissions officers find far more compelling than overly formal or generic writing.
Writer's block and choosing the right topic are the biggest hurdles—with so many prompts and personal stories to consider, students often feel paralyzed by options. Other common struggles include organizing ideas coherently, showing rather than telling, and managing time across multiple essays for different schools. Personalized tutoring helps you work through these obstacles systematically, turning vague ideas into polished, compelling narratives.
Revision is critical—most strong college essays go through 3-5 rounds of feedback and refinement. Tutors help you move beyond surface-level editing (grammar and punctuation) to deeper revision work: clarifying your main message, strengthening your examples, and ensuring every sentence serves your story. This iterative process is where your essay truly comes alive, transforming a good draft into one that stands out to admissions committees.
Ideally, start in the summer before your senior year or early fall—this gives you time to brainstorm, draft, and revise without rushing. However, tutors can help at any stage: if you're already mid-process, they can provide targeted feedback on existing drafts; if you're just starting, they can guide you from topic selection through final polish. The key is starting early enough to allow multiple revision cycles before your application deadlines.
